One finding of the research concerns the days of the week with the highest incidence of fraud attempts: 15,1% occurred on Fridays. What is the day with the highest sales volume, and when does it occur? 15,91 TP3T of the 35 million online transactionsHowever, the peak time for attacks was 2:00 PMwhile the smallest record was observed at 4 hours From the early morning. During the weekend, especially on Sundays, sales numbers and fraud attempts are lower, corresponding to 11,3%.
Despite this, "the data reveals the most frequent behavioral patterns of fraudsters, who typically act during peak e-commerce hours to blend in with legitimate transactions, making detection more difficult. This underscores the importance of e-commerce companies investing in monitoring and prevention technology, keeping pace with the evolving innovations of fraudsters themselves," highlights Rogério Signorini, Vice President of Products and Pre-Sales at Equifax BoaVista.
